Abstract

Social participation is a prerequisite for sustainability, but stakeholder engagement is conditioned by their perception of value and results of collective efforts. The MARGov Project - Collaborative Governance of Marine Protected Areas was developed in the region of Sesimbra, Portugal. This paper focus participants’ assessment of the MARGov Project, aiming to reveal aspects favoring stakeholder engagement and, therefore, MARGov achievements. Thus, we’ve applied content analysis, based on thematic categories and on evaluative categories inspired by the SWOT Analysis, on semi-structured interviews in which 17 stakeholders from six different social groups evaluated the MARGov Project, considering aspects that influenced its process (execution) and its results. The analyzes revealed that, although the negative evaluations prevail in the texts, these were mostly based on elements of the context that reveal the measure of the challenge of reconciling interests in a highly anthropized environmental area. As for the internal aspects of the project, positive evaluations predominate in the interviews and represent the participants' recognition about the importance of the MARGov Project. Nevertheless, negatively evaluated internal aspects deserve attention because they sign weaknesses and point out opportunities for improving the Project.
